InsureMyTrip.Com's Travel Insurance Tips for Protecting Your Summer Vacation
Date:5/7/2008

WARWICK, R.I., May 7 /PRNewswire/ -- Despite a weakened economy, a challenging airline industry, and sky rocketing fuel prices, Americans aren't giving up their summer vacation plans, travel industry experts observe; but they are scaling back.

(Logo: http://www.newscom.com/cgi-bin/prnh/20070529/NETU076LOGO )

Jim Grace, President and CEO of InsureMyTrip.com, the leading online travel insurance comparison site, agrees. "At InsureMyTrip.com, we are seeing noticeable changes in the trips our customers are taking. This time last year we provided critical insurance protection for a tremendous amount of vacations to the Caribbean, Europe, and elsewhere overseas. The summer of 2008 however, seems to be about vacationing closer to home."

But whether you're trading a villa in Tuscany for a beach house on Cape Cod, or an African safari for the wilds of Disney's Animal Kingdom, one fact still holds true: "Travel insurance is the best way to protect all of your travels and trip investments during this challenging time," says Grace. "While travel insurance can't prevent things from going wrong, it can help ease your travel woes and get your journey back on track."

The key is to plan ahead. Travel insurance, like all insurance, is predicated on the occurrence of unforeseen events. You need to purchase travel insurance before your trip for maximum coverage and peace of mind protection against the unexpected. "It only takes one bad travel experience for a person to understand that trip insurance is not a luxury, it's a necessity," explains Grace. "Travel insurance is your best defense against many of the most common risks affecting travel today."
